What are the most common Ford repair issues for vehicles in Thompson, PA, given the local climate and rural roads?

Due to Thompson's hilly terrain and harsh winters, common issues include premature brake wear, suspension component fatigue from rough roads, and corrosion from road salt. For Ford trucks and SUVs popular here, 4WD system maintenance and addressing rust on frames and body panels are also frequent local service needs.

When should I seek immediate service for my Ford's 4WD or AWD system living in Thompson?

Seek immediate service if you hear grinding noises from the front axle or transfer case, or if the 4WD system fails to engage, especially before winter. Proper function is critical for safe travel on steep, unplowed roads like those in Elk Mountain or surrounding rural areas.

What local factors should I consider when scheduling Ford truck maintenance in Thompson?

Schedule brake and tire checks before winter due to steep grades and seasonal weather. Also, consider the agricultural and hauling use common in the area; if you use your Ford F-Series for towing or farm work, adhere to more frequent transmission and fluid service intervals than standard recommendations.
